Java Developer

We are looking for a new colleague to join our growing FinTech team. Someone with awesome collaboration skills, excellent coding habits and the eagerness to build great software. If you think you would be a good fit, please carry on reading.

 

What we expect from you

  • Solid Java experience
  • Knowledge of relational and NoSQL databases
  • High quality code covered with extensive tests
  • Experience working in continuous deployment environment
  • Strong communication skills
  • Team player with the ‘Getting things done’ attitude towards work

 

What we’d like from you

  • Experience building scalable cloud-based Java applications
  • Experience with Spring framework (MVC, Data, DI, AOP)
  • Understanding of online banking, core banking and processing systems
  • Knowledge of distributed systems and software integration patterns

 

Other skills we appreciate

  • Interest in DevOps (Chef, Docker, AWS)
  • Interest in Test Automation (BDD, Cucumber)
  • Knowledge of or interest in Front-end development (React, Redux, ES2015, Webpack)
  • Experience with Scala (Akka) or other functional languages
  • Deep knowledge of OAuth and similar authentication mechanisms
  • Knowledge of security/cryptographic methodologies

 

Check out our stack here, in a nutshell

  • Java11
  • Kotlin, Scala
  • MongoDB
  • Kafka
  • Maven, Jenkins, Git, Chef
  • JUnit, Mockito
  • Crucible, JIRA

 

If you like what you’re reading, let us know. Maybe we will make a great team together. Do you have a question whether you match well with the requirements? Let us know anyway and participate in our code academy.

Are you interested?
cool
Fill out the form and get a ticket!

Contact us

Please enter name
Please enter a valid e-mail address
Please enter a valid phone number
Please enter a valid link to your CV